"Tomber in Apples": Cancer, Singer Maxime Le Forestier (76) Evokes His Disease with Philosophy

Summary by Pleine Vie
On October 17, 2024, Maxime Le Forestier worried his admirers by falling on stage during his antibois concert. Guest of the Journal Unexpected on RTL on October 28, the interpreter of "Né somewhere" wanted to reassure on his state of health.
